1. Smart Passive Income
Founded by Pat Flynn – Smart Passive Income is an awesome blog for entrepreneurs, marketers and bloggers. Pat considers himself the dummy of seeing what works and what doesn’t in entrepreneurship. Definitely check it out if you don’t follow it already.
2. Gary Vaynerchuk
Speaking of Gary Vaynerchuk, his own personal blog gives you a background on his entrepreneurial success and shares brilliant advice he’s learnt throughout his journey to success.
3. Guy Kawasaki
Guy Kawasaki is a successful evangelist, author and speaker. If you haven’t heard about him before then it’s definitely worth reading more about him. Take a look at his blog for a more personal touch on evangelism.
4. Entrepreneur on Fire
Founded by John Lee Dumas – Entrepreneur on Fire is a blog/podcast where John has interview tonnes of successful entrepreneurs such as the likes of Gary Vaynerchuk, Seth Godin, Tim Ferris, Brian Tracy and so on. If you’re into pod-casts this is a must.
5. Entrepreneurs Journey
Founded by Yaro Starak – Entrepreneurs Journey is all about teaching you the secrets and methods to be able to live the laptop lifestyle. This blog is great for anyone who’s building a blog or an online business and wants to learn how to market their websites.
6. The Entrepreneurs Library
Found by Wade Danielson – The Entrepreneurs Library is an excellent resource for fining out the best books to read for entrepreneurs. However, the blog also shares great business lessons and Wade also hosts regular podcasts to go with it.
7. Startup Savant
Founded by Ryan James – Startup Savant is run by a good friend of mine, and is blog giving out great entrepreneurial advice and tools, but one that also gives back to the community by donating to organizations.
8. Steve Blank
Steve Blank’s story is so detailed that I won’t go into it right now. You can read more about him and his life on the ‘About’ page of his blog. However, he offers books, guides, tools and videos for startups, and has plenty of experience. So it’s worth checking him out.
9. Social Triggers
Founded by Derek Halpern – Social Triggers is a hugely successful blog ranked 17,455 in the world. Derek shares great advice on building your business, marketing your product and gaining more customers.
10. 4 Hour Work Week
Founded by Tim Ferris – The New York Times best seller created 4 Hour Work Week in order to help you escape the boring 9-5 grind and live the life you’ve always wanted.
11. Jared Reitzin
Jared Reitzin is an entrepreneur and speaker who gives in depth advice on his personal blog to help resource-less entrepreneurs build their own business.
12. Women on Business
Founded by Susan Gunelius – Women on Business presents a great focus that not many sites aim for specifically, and that is female entrepreneurs. The site was founded in 2007 and since then has become a key resource for the female entrepreneurs of the world.
13. Seth Godin
Seth Godin is a best selling author and has written a total of 18 books. His blog has become so popular that you can find it in Google just by searching the keyword “Seth”. This blog definitely deserves to be regarded as one of the best blogs for entrepreneurs.
14. Mike Michalowicz
Mike Michalowicz is the author of Toilet Paper Entrepreneur. An excellent book about starting a business that’s been featured on various new websites such as ‘The New York Times’ and ‘Wall Street Journal’. Check out Mike’s personal blog for more great content of starting a business.
15. Copy Blogger
Founded by Brian Clark – Copy Blogger has been described as the Bible of content marketing. It was founded back in January 2006 and since then the team has grown and the business has grown into 8 figures in yearly revenue. Definitely a marketing blog to check out!
16. Think Entrepreneurship
Founded by Pete Sveen – Think Entrepreneurship is a great blog that incorporates motivational and blogging articles within the general categories of entrepreneurship. A perfect blog for entrepreneurs that are interested in all three areas.
17. Under 30 CEO
Founded by Matt Wilson – Under 30 CEO is an entrepreneurial blog that focuses on travelling as well as entrepreneurship, since himself and his co-founder Jared own their own travel company. Great advice for entrepreneurs who love to travel.
18. Suitcase Entrepreneur
Founded by Natalie Sisson – The Suitcase Entrepreneur is another excellent blog that incorporates travel within it, as Natalie did just that and built her online business to six figures whilst doing so. The advice she shares on her blog is incredibly useful for travelling entrepreneurs.
19. Venture Hacks
Founded by Nivi Babak and Naval Ravikant – Venture Hacks is a very simplistic blog that offers great advice for new startups.
20. Chris Ducker
Chris Ducker’s personal blog is another brilliant blog on growing your business, fortunate enough to be featured in Forbes, Inc, The Huffington Post and Business Insider. His site has just gone through a brilliant redesign, so check it out!
21. Next Shark
Founded by Benny Luo – Next Shark is an online magazine that aims to offer a fresh take on business and includes a great combination of personal growth and business advice.
22. Lifestyle Entrepreneur Blog
Founded by Jesse Krieger – Lifestyle Entrepreneur Blog shares “stories and strategies for entrepreneurial success”. Jesse is a best selling author shares great articles on success as an entrepreneur.
23. Peter Shallard
Peter Shallard likes to call himself ‘the shrink for entrepreneurs’. Instead of sharing techniques and methods on how to build your business, Peter digs deeper into the mindset of entrepreneurs. Helping you become stronger mentally in order to be a successful entrepreneur.
24. Blogtrepreneur
Founded by Matthew and Adam Toren – Blogtrepreneur was created as a resource for both bloggers and entrepreneurs; combining the two areas for incredibly relevant advice towards other blogtrepreneurs. It’s now become one of the top blogs for entrepreneurs.
25. Braid Creative
Founded by Tara Street and Kathleen Shannon – Braid Creative is a blog/coaching and consulting company that helps other entrepreneurs in developing their brand. They have various courses and coaching options available if you’re interested in working with them.
26. Frugal Entrepreneur
Founded by Adam Gottlieb – Frugal Entrepreneur offers various business documents for startups that are struggling to find them anywhere else, as well as hosting a blog to go right along side them with great advice.
27. Epic Launch
Founded by Ben Lang – Epic Launch is a great blog for advice on entrepreneurship and online business.
28. On Startups
Founded by Dharmesh Shah – OnStartups has been one of the best blogs for entrepreneurs for a while now. Dharmesh is the founder of HubSpot and Pyramid Digital Solutions, so his content’s definitely worth a read!
29. Both Sides of the Table
Founded by Mark Suster – Both Sides of the Table offers advice on marketing, sales and startup lessons.
30. Small Business Trends
Founded by Anita Campbell – Small Business Trends has been operating since 2003 and now reaches more than 6 million readers annually. The fact that this blog has been going for so long and covers so many areas, makes it one of the best blogs for entrepreneurs.
31. All Business
Much like Small Business Trends, ‘All Business’ is another blog that has been running for quite a while and has grown into an incredibly large resource for entrepreneurs. It’s been featured in places like Forbes, The New York Times, USA Today and The Wall Street Journal.
32. Marco Arment
Marco Arment is a web and app developer, as well as writer and podcaster. He was the lead developer of Tumbler, and founded many other projects before selling them on.
33. Young Upstarts
Founded by Daniel Goh – Young Upstarts is a blog that focuses more on leadership and the younger generation, in changing the world through entrepreneurship.
34. Duct Tape Marketing
Founded by John Jantsch – Duct Tape Marketing has been regarded as one of the best marketing blogs for quite some time now. John offers several courses and also a podcast you can tune into.
35. Read Write Start
Founded by Richard MacManus – Read Write Start has been operating since 2003, giving out advice for entrepreneurs within the categories: mobile technology, social, the cloud and the web.
36. Brian Solis
Brian Solis is an award winning author and keynote speaker. Have a look at his website for marketing advice, technology articles and more.
37. A VC
Founded by Fred Wilson – A VC is a very basic style of blog, but has literally thousands of published articles that you can learn some great knowledge from.
38. Small Business Brief
Founded by Jennifer Laycock & Robert Clough – Small Business Brief has been running since 2004 and offers solid advice on business marketing, finance, operations and technology.
39. The Next Women
The Next Women is a great business magazine that again specifically targets female entrepreneurs just like ‘Women on business’. However much of the advice is applicable to entrepreneurs in general, not just females.
40. Chris Brogan
Chris Brogan is the CEO of Owner Media Group and New York Times bestselling author. Check out his blog for more information on him and what he does.
